Web4 Jul 2024 · 11. Groundnuts (Apios americana) Another vine that can give an edible yield, though less well known, is Apios americana, also known as groundnuts, or hopniss. This vine has edible beans and large edible tubers. It grows up to 19.7ft long, and also has attractive flowers in pink, purple or reddish-brown hues. WebShop Jeepers Creepers 2 [DVD] [2003]. Web14 Nov 2024 · It is a woody shrub vine which climbs without clinging roots, tendrils, or thorns. Its stem goes into a crack in the bark of fibrous barked trees (such as bald cypress ). The stem flattens and grows up the tree underneath the host tree's outer bark. The fetterbush then sends out branches that emerge near the top of the tree. WebSedum ‘Sea Star’.
